Ingredients
For the Bread Pudding
- 16 oz loaf of French bread (454g)
- 3 ¾ cups whole milk
- 1 ½ cup heavy cream
- 7 large eggs
- 1 tsp vanilla
- 1 ¼ cup sugar
- Optional zest of 1/2 an orange
How to Make Custard Bread Pudding with Vanilla Sauce
Step 1: Prepare the Bread
Begin by cutting the French bread into cubes. Place them in a large mixing bowl and set aside.
Step 2: Mix the Custard Base
In another mixing bowl:
1. Whisk together the eggs, sugar, whole milk, heavy cream, and vanilla.
2. If using, add the optional orange zest for added flavor.
Step 3: Combine Bread with Custard Mixture
Pour the custard mixture over the cubed bread. Allow it to soak for about 30 minutes, stirring occasionally to ensure all pieces are coated.
Step 4: Bake the Pudding
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C).
1. Transfer the soaked bread mixture into a greased baking dish.
2. Bake for approximately 120 minutes, or until the top is golden brown and a knife inserted in the center comes out clean.
Step 5: Prepare Vanilla Sauce (Optional)
While baking, you can prepare a simple vanilla sauce if desired:
1. In a saucepan, combine equal parts water and sugar over medium heat until dissolved.
2. Add vanilla extract once removed from heat.
Serve your warm custard bread pudding drizzled with vanilla sauce for an unforgettable dessert experience!

How to Perfect Custard Bread Pudding with Vanilla Sauce
Achieving the perfect custard bread pudding requires attention to detail. Here are some tips to ensure your dessert turns out wonderfully every time.
- Use Stale Bread: Stale French bread absorbs more custard without becoming mushy.
- Let it Soak: Allow the bread to soak in the custard mixture for at least 30 minutes before baking for optimal flavor.
- Control Oven Temperature: Bake at a low temperature to prevent the edges from cooking too quickly while ensuring the center sets properly.
- Check Doneness with a Knife: Insert a knife into the center; it should come out clean when fully baked.
- Cool Before Serving: Let your pudding cool slightly before serving; this helps it set and enhances flavors.

Storage & Reheating Instructions
Refrigerator Storage
- Store in an airtight container.
- The custard bread pudding lasts up to 3–4 days in the fridge.
Freezing Custard Bread Pudding with Vanilla Sauce
- Wrap tightly in plastic wrap or use a freezer-safe container.
- It can be frozen for up to 2 months for best quality.
Reheating Custard Bread Pudding with Vanilla Sauce
- Oven: Preheat to 350°F (175°C) and cover with foil. Bake for about 20-25 minutes until warmed through.
- Microwave: Heat individual portions on medium power for 1-2 minutes, checking frequently to avoid overheating.
- Stovetop: Place in a saucepan over low heat, stirring occasionally until warmed.

Ingredients
- 16 oz loaf of French bread
- 3 ¾ cups whole milk
- 1 ½ cup heavy cream
- 7 large eggs
- 1 tsp vanilla extract
- 1 ¼ cup sugar
- Optional: zest of ½ orange
Instructions
-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C).
- Cut the French bread into cubes and place them in a large mixing bowl.
- In another bowl, whisk together eggs, sugar, whole milk, heavy cream, vanilla extract, and optional orange zest.
- Pour the custard mixture over the cubed bread and let it soak for about 30 minutes, stirring occasionally.
- Transfer the soaked mixture into a greased baking dish and bake for approximately 120 minutes until golden brown and set.
- While baking, prepare the vanilla sauce by dissolving equal parts water and sugar over medium heat; add vanilla after removing from heat.
- Serve warm drizzled with vanilla sauce.
- Prep Time: 20 minutes
- Cook Time: 120 minutes
- Category: Dessert
- Method: Baking
- Cuisine: American
